A “Maker” is anyone who dabbles in the science, technology, and art worlds to create something. The Irondequoit Public Library 1839 Maker’s Lab provides the tools, equipment, and training that allow people to create these kinds of projects.

In-Library Use
We offer more complex equipment for use in the Maker’s Lab. You can be trained on these items through an in-person class or a self-directed tutorial. Patrons must be 18 or older and will be required to sign the Maker’s Lab User Agreement and to show photo ID and a Monroe County library card in good standing before each reservation.

You can reserve the Maker’s Lab up to two (2) times per week for up to four (4) hours per session through our Room Calendar. The Maker’s Lab may be reserved up to 60 days in advance.
If the Maker’s Lab is not in use and there are no prior reservations or library programs, walk-in use may be available. Please speak to staff at the reference desk on the second floor to check availability or reserve the Maker’s Lab using the Room Calendar. Walk-ins will still be required to show their library card and photo ID and to sign the Maker’s Lab User Agreement prior to each use.
All Maker’s Lab use must end 30 minutes before library closing time.

Seed Library
We currently have a selection of vegetables and ornamental flowers available, and patrons are able to take up to five packets to start their own home garden. We also have jars of bulk seeds, which we are asking you to limit to one scoop. Planting instructions are available for all seeds.
And if you’d like to return seeds that you cultivated, we’ll gladly take them! Please return any seeds with a Seed Donation Form so we can share them again with the community.

Glowforge
A Glowforge, a laser-powered crafting machine that you can use to create personalized and unique items, is available for in-library use only. Library staff will print your project and contact you when it’s ready for pick up.
Cost: $2.00 First 15 Minutes + $1.00 Each Additional 15 Minutes

Ghost Hunting Kit
Our Ghost Hunting Kit includes everything you need to search for a ghostly spirit:
— Spirit Box – Used for communication with radio waves.
— EMF Reader – Used for sensing changes in electromagnetic fields.
— Voice Recorder – Used for recording sessions and picking up electronic voice phenomena (EVPs).
— Infared Thermometer – Used to scan for changes in temperature.
— Dowsing Rods and Pendulum – Used for communication.
— Head Lamps – Used for illumination and safety.
— Haunted Rochester: A Supernatural History of the Lower Genesee by Mason Winfield
— Ghost-Hunting For Dummies by Zak Bagans

3D Printer
Our 3D Printer is an Anycubic Kobra Max 2 and is available for in-library use only. Library staff will print your project and contact you when it’s ready for pick up.
Filetypes Supported: STL, OBJ, and 3MF
Max Print Size: 19.7″ x 16.5″ x 16.5″
Cost: $2.00 Base Price + $0.35 Per Meter of Filament Used
